Transaction 63e5569ebc1e12d9ff19233fcd920f40f2e2b5241a5cbebb3bd500663d76fdc1
3 Input
2 Outputs
- 63e5569ebc1e12d9ff19233fcd920f40f2e2b5241a5cbebb3bd500663d76fdc1:0
- 63e5569ebc1e12d9ff19233fcd920f40f2e2b5241a5cbebb3bd500663d76fdc1:1
value 59853
address 17oLxzeLVmXGLbUjy93qq5dkdSnax6n9uC
value 1286712
address 138juRmvX9WykCHp8jVTWDfuHA8opr819A